The compliance of purchasing Aurigami (LRC) in India
**Compliance Description for Purchasing Aurigami (LRC) in India** **Regulatory Framework** - Reserve Bank of India (RBI): The RBI regulates digital asset transactions and provides guidelines for cryptocurrency exchanges operating within India. Users should familiarize themselves with RBI's stance on cryptocurrencies to ensure compliance. -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I): SEBI oversees securities markets in India. While Aurigami (LRC) may not be classified as a security, users should be aware of any potential regulatory updates that could affect the trading of digital assets. - Income Tax Department: The Indian government considers profits from cryptocurrency trading as taxable income. Users must understand their tax obligations related to capital gains and income tax to remain compliant. **Compliance Considerations for Users** - Tax Obligations: Users purchasing Aurigami (LRC) should maintain accurate records of their transactions, as the Income Tax Department requires reporting of capital gains from cryptocurrency investments. - Know Your Customer (KYC) Requirements: Most exchanges require users to complete KYC verification to comply with anti-money laundering (AML) regulations. Users must provide valid identification and personal information during the registration process. - Anti-Money Laundering (AML) Regulations: Users should be aware that cryptocurrency exchanges are required to implement AML practices to prevent illicit activities. This may include transaction monitoring and reporting suspicious activities. **Best Practices for Users** - Choose Reputable Exchanges: Select exchanges that are compliant with RBI and SEBI regulations, ensuring a secure and trustworthy environment for purchasing Aurigami (LRC). - Stay Informed: Keep up-to-date with changes in regulations and tax laws related to cryptocurrencies in India. This will help users make informed decisions regarding their investments. - Secure Personal Information: Ensure that personal information is protected when providing data to exchanges. Use strong passwords and enable two-factor authentication to enhance security. - Record Keeping: Maintain detailed records of all transactions involving Aurigami (LRC), including dates, amounts, and transaction IDs. This will aid in accurate tax reporting and support in case of audits. **Conclusion** For users looking to purchase Aurigami (LRC) in India, understanding the compliance landscape is essential to avoid potential legal pitfalls. By adhering to regulatory requirements, staying informed about the evolving landscape, and following best practices, users can confidently navigate the digital asset market in India. Ensuring compliance not only protects users but also promotes a safer and more transparent cryptocurrency ecosystem.
